    Here are some ideas for you on how to review:

    1. Chapter review, no matter which discipline is divided into large chapters and small class hours, generally when all the lessons of a chapter are finished, the whole chapter will be strung together in the system to talk about it again, as a review, we can also do this, because since it is a chapter of knowledge, all the class hours must be related before, so we can find out what they have in common, and use the associative memory method to string these fragmented knowledge through the line, which is more convenient for us to remember.

    2. Rotate to review, although we learn more than one subject, but some students like a single review, for example, the language is not good, they have been working the review of the language, and other subjects are not asked, in fact, this is a bad habit, when people do one thing repeatedly for a long time, it is inevitable that fatigue will occur, and the expected effect will not be achieved, so we should not review a single subject when we do the review, we should take turns to review, look at the language and look tired, change the mathematics, and then change the English, This can turn the monotonous revision into a fun thing to do, and thus improve the revision effect.

    3. Error correction: It is inevitable to make mistakes in the process of doing questions, whether you are careless or just not, you must habitually collect these wrong questions, and each subject has a set of wrong questions, when we review before the exam, they are the key review objects, so since you miss once, you may not be wrong the second time, only in this way will you not lose points again on the same issue.

    4. Mind map review: Mind map is a great invention, which can systematize and visualize the information in your brain in memory, and can also help you analyze problems and plan as a whole. Drawing knowledge with a mind map to organize and memorize it can quickly analyze the context and focus of knowledge, and remember it firmly.

    Explain the process, such as the movement of IS-LM, don't just use your brain, review professional courses to be more hands-on requirements are to have drawings and to combine graphic analysis, but if it is 211, the production theory of the conditions for enterprises to continue to produce, etc., these must be drawn, if you don't draw, it is likely that there will be only half of the score, the basic concept should be clear and correct, the review of professional courses must focus on the foundation and framework, good memory is not as good as a bad pen, if you are taking a very general school may require not to draw, there must be a framework structure between knowledge, They can form a connection with each other, don't memorize the picture, but understand it, and at the same time, such as Southwestern University of Finance and Economics and Zhongnan University of Economics and Law, drawing pictures is a must.

    1. Take the textbook as the foundation, take the syllabus as the outline, and eat the textbook thoroughly. The exam questions must be based on the specified textbook, not the teaching materials of a certain publishing house. Almost 100% of the usual exam questions can be found in textbooks – of course, after multiple layers of synthesis and deepening.

    2. Write the book three times. The first time should be based on the overall browsing, and strive to understand the summary of the whole book, and do not require understanding of each specific knowledge point; The second time to carefully sort out the key and difficult points; The third time is to reorganize and memorize the knowledge points. After doing this three times, the book is basically read.

    3. The book is almost finished, and the knowledge system is sorted out, so let's start working on the questions. We must grasp a principle when doing questions: first seek refinement, and then seek more; Seek slow first, then seek fast; Seek quality first, then quantity.

    4. Memorize the topic. The so-called memorization is a more vivid statement, which does not mean that you must memorize the entire topic. Instead, after doing it, put the workbook that I had done. The test papers and so on are saved and taken out at regular intervals in the future.
